Cooking Beef Short Ribs Recipe Seasoned with Oxtail Seasoning

This cooking beef short ribs recipe seasoned with oxtail seasoning delivers tender, flavorful ribs infused with bold Caribbean spices. Slow-cooked or braised to perfection, these ribs are juicy, fall-off-the-bone delicious, and perfect for a hearty meal. Serve them with mashed potatoes, roasted vegetables, or rice for a complete dish.

Ingredients

For the Short Ribs:

  • 34 lbs beef short ribs
  • 2 tbsp oxtail seasoning
  • 1 tbsp smoked paprika
  • 1 tbs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p onion powder
  • 1 tsp salt
  • ½ tsp black pepper
  • 2 tbsp olive oil (for searing)
  • 1 large onion,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 medium carrots, chopped
  • 2 celery stalks, chopped
  • 2 cups beef broth (or red wine)
  • 2 sprigs fresh thyme

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Ribs

    • Pat the short ribs dry and trim any excess fat.
    • In a bowl, mix oxtail seasoning,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per.
    • Rub the spice mix generously over the ribs and let them marinate for at least 2 hours (or overnight for best results).
  2. Sear the Ribs

    • Heat olive oil in a Dutch oven over medium-high heat.
    • Sear the ribs on all sides until browned, then remove and set aside.
  3. Cook the Vegetables

    • In the same pot, add onions, garlic, carrots, and celery. Sauté until softened.
  4. Braise the Ribs

    • Pour in beef broth (or red wine), scraping up any browned bits.
    • Return the ribs to the pot, add thyme sprigs, and cover.
    • Simmer on low heat for 2.5 to 3 hours or until the ribs are fork-tender.
  5. Serve and Enjoy

    • Remove ribs from the pot and let them rest for 5 minutes.
    • Serve with mashed potatoes, roasted vegetables, or rice.

Notes

  • For extra depth of flavor, marinate the ribs overnight.
  • You can substitute beef broth with red wine for a richer taste.
  • To make it spicier, add a chopped Scotch bonnet pepper.
